Post by Raven X Army on May 18, 2017 12:06:14 GMT
I'd suggest you take that record out of that glass cabinet display and keep it in the darkest place you can find. These covers are prone to yellowing when exposed to sun/daylight

|
|
Post by deluxxx777 on May 23, 2017 18:41:32 GMT
Just my 2 cent : a little bit of yellowing is fine, we talking about a record from '89. from the pics I've seen around, some copies are really white, but most are yellowed. Would like to see a really white sleeve compared with a WBF Record release for example, my ck looks pretty white but side by side with the WBF RR is definitely yellowed, and looks cool to me. However now is stored in a double poly bag protection, and I made a thick cardboard whit stickers to protect records from the light.
